Let’s go back to the book of Genesis and continue to embrace our journey through the journey of Abram.
Genesis 14:11-13New International Version (NIV)
11 The four kings seized all the goods of Sodom and Gomorrah and all their food; then they went away. 12 They also carried off Abram’s nephew Lot and his possessions, since he was living in Sodom.
13 A man who had escaped came and reported this to Abram the Hebrew.
Genesis 14:15-16New International Version (NIV)
15 During the night Abram divided his men to attack them and he routed them, pursuing them as far as Hobah, north of Damascus. 16 He recovered all the goods and brought back his relative Lot and his possessions, together with the women and the other people.

Genesis 14:18-20
Melchizedek the king of Salem, a Godly king shows up and enters into holy covenant with Abram. Forward Thinkers, he brings bread and wine which is symbolic of Jesus Christ and the Lord’s Supper. Forward Thinkers, thank God He never leaves us alone at the mercy of evil people.
Forward Thinkers, Abram puts his trust in God and rejects the evil king and his stuff, giving us an example of how to lead with integrity in the midst of evil.
Forward Thinkers, here are 5 things we can learn from Abram’s encounter.
1) Abram put his trust in God
2) Abram enters into covenant with God
3) Abram blessed by God
4) Abram’s enemies defeated by God
5) Abram honors God with his tithes
Genesis 14:22
Forward Thinkers, Abram tells the evil king of Sodom who was in a position to pour money and material possessions into his life; I trust God and I will not accept one dime from you and you’ll never be able to say, ‘I made Abram rich’.
